What It Is:
This is a word search puzzle titled 'Beer Types Mania.' The puzzle grid is diamond-shaped and contains a mix of letters. Below the grid is a word list featuring beer types: HEFEWEIZEN, BERLINER, PILSNER, ALTBIER, WITBIER, and TRIPEL. The instructions indicate words are hidden horizontally and vertically.
